Hello Everybody,

Well, I received PPR a couple of weeks ago from London visa Office (LVO). However, due to the advanced stage of my wife's pregnancy, I asked LVO to postpone our landing till my wife gives birth which is due by the end of this week.

So LVO instructed me to add the baby to our application once born and they sent me the following instructions:

==========================
· processing fee for your child (if accompanying you to Canada) – you may pay online here: https://eservices.cic.gc.ca/epay/
· your child’s birth certificate
· copy of your child’s valid passport
· 4 recent photographs of your child
· updated IMM0008 Generic for yourself and updated IMM5406 “Additional Family Information” form for yourself and your spouse.
· a “Certificat de Sélection du Québec” for your child ( in his or her name), if you wish to immigrate to the province of Québec (http://www.micc.gouv.qc.ca/fr/index.asp)
Copies of the original documents with original certified translations into English or French are required. All documents must be sent by mail.
Your child must undergo a medical examination. Please wait until we add the baby and send you the medical instruction.
Application forms and photo specifications are available on our Web site: http://www.cic.gc.ca/english/pdf/kits/guides/3901e.pdf
==========================

Here it is my case updated, I have sent LVO the following documents by email and new born is added the same day to my application :

1- New Born Passport
2- New Born Birth certificate
3- New Born Upfront Medical
4- New Born Payment Receipt
5- New Born Photo
6- Updated IMM008 for main applicant
7- Updated IMM5406 for main applicant and spouse
8- Updated PoF
